Section 3 - Configuration
The DDNS feature allows you to host a server (Web, FTP, Game Server, etc...) using a domain name that you have purchased (www.whateveryournameis.
com) with your dynamically assigned IP address. Most broadband Internet Service Providers assign dynamic (changing) IP addresses. Using a DDNS
service provider, your friends can enter in your domain name to connect to your server no matter what your IP address is.
Enable DDNS:
Dynamic Domain Name System is a method of
keeping a domain name linked to a changing IP
Address. Check the box to enable DDNS.
Server Address:
Choose your DDNS provider from the drop down
menu.
Host Name:
Enter the Host Name that you registered with
your DDNS service provider.
Username or Key:
Enter the Username for your DDNS account.
Timeout:
Enter a time in (hours).
Status:
Displays the current connection status to your
DDNS server.
Click the Save Settings button to save any changes made.
